Chemical composition % of the ladle analysis of grade IMI 679 and Standards
Titanium IMI 679 (Ti-11Sn-5Zr-2.25Al-1Mo-0.25Si), Oil-Quenched and Aged
Categories: Metal; Nonferrous Metal; Titanium Alloy; Alpha/Near Alpha Titanium Alloy
Material Notes: Alpha Prime Transus 880ºC. Tensile Properties below after oil quench/aged heat treatment: 900°C/OQ, 500°C/24hr/AC.
Key Words: Ti11Sn5Zr2.25Al1Mo0.25Si
Physical Properties Metric English Comments
Density 4.84 g/cc 0.175 lb/in³
Mechanical Properties Metric English Comments
Tensile Strength, Ultimate 1110 MPa 161000 psi
Tensile Strength, Yield 970 MPa 141000 psi
Elongation at Break 8.00 % 8.00 %
Reduction of Area 25.0 % 25.0 %
Modulus of Elasticity 115 GPa 16700 ksi Typical value for an alpha titanium alloy
Poissons Ratio 0.310 0.310 Typical for alpha titanium alloy.
Fatigue Strength 110 MPa
@# of Cycles 1.00e+7 16000 psi
@# of Cycles 1.00e+7 Kt = 3.0; R = -1.0 (air-cooled and aged sample)
200 MPa
@# of Cycles 50000 29000 psi
@# of Cycles 50000 Kt = 3.0; R = -1.0 (air-cooled and aged sample)
390 MPa
@# of Cycles 1.00e+7 56600 psi
@# of Cycles 1.00e+7 (air-cooled and aged sample)
590 MPa
@# of Cycles 50000 85600 psi
@# of Cycles 50000 (air-cooled and aged sample)
Shear Modulus 43.9 GPa 6370 ksi Calculated from typical values.
Electrical Properties Metric English Comments
Electrical Resistivity 0.000160 ohm-cm 0.000160 ohm-cm
Thermal Properties Metric English Comments
CTE, linear 8.60 µm/m-°C
@Temperature 20.0 °C 4.78 µin/in-°F
@Temperature 68.0 °F
9.30 µm/m-°C
@Temperature 250 °C 5.17 µin/in-°F
@Temperature 482 °F
10.0 µm/m-°C
@Temperature 500 °C 5.56 µin/in-°F
@Temperature 932 °F
Specific Heat Capacity 0.500 J/g-°C 0.120 BTU/lb-°F
Thermal Conductivity 8.30 W/m-K 57.6 BTU-in/hr-ft²-°F
Maximum Service Temperature, Air 450 °C 842 °F
Beta Transus 880 °C 1620 °F
Component Elements Properties Metric English Comments
Aluminum, Al 2.25 % 2.25 %
Molybdenum, Mo 1.0 % 1.0 %
Silicon, Si 0.25 % 0.25 %
Tin, Sn 11.0 % 11.0 %
Titanium, Ti 81.0 % 81.0 %
Zirconium, Zr 5.0 % 5.0 %
